CBCOB aims to win against Delfos

CBC Old Boys that’s in the top five in the first quarter of Eastern Cricket Premier league was beaten by North West University (NWU) by 163 runs in the Club Super League on home soil on November 26.

A batsman of NWU, Senuran Muthusamy, who is also a former player of the Proteas, kept bowlers of CBC Old Boys on their toes with exceptional strikes. He smashed 105 runs not out from 102 balls.

The bowlers of CBC Old Boys Boksburg didn’t disappoint. They managed to pull stunning bowling performances. Zander Lubbe scooped 4/57 in 10 overs while Robert Mutch finished with 0/31 in nine overs.

WP Myburgh made 31 (66) with Michael Weldon getting 20 (13).

Boksburg outfit will be looking to redeem itself when takes on Delfos Cricket Club in December.
